Output 5bbf3582f94538a4f42e689d69ef910ca1897e0373c463172b48826c6162485a:1

value
18292241
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7bc039b993ed7b67b4c7c0001a34bc14a28112c OP_EQUALVERIFY OP_CHECKSIG
address
1LfhWh81dQdpNupjPre2srzQM8uYXzTjZf
transaction
5bbf3582f94538a4f42e689d69ef910ca1897e0373c463172b48826c6162485a
spent
true